Understanding Double Glazing
Double glazing consists of 2 panes of glass separated by an area filled with gas-- usually argon-- developed to decrease heat transfer. This results in better insulation, keeping homes warmer in winter and cooler in summertime while likewise reducing noise pollution from the outside.

With time, double glazing can weaken. Here are some typical indicators that it might be time to consider a replacement.
1. Condensation between Panes
One of the most common signs of a stopping working double glazing system is condensation forming between the glass panes. This indicates that the seal has broken, permitting wetness to get in the space in between the panes.
2. Drafts and Cold Spots
If you see cold drafts or particular areas in your home that are regularly colder than others, it may suggest that your double glazing is no longer offering appropriate insulation.
3. Increased Energy Bills
Considerable boosts in your energy expenses can signify inefficient windows. If your double glazing is not functioning appropriately, your heating or cooling systems should work more difficult to preserve a comfortable temperature.
4. Difficulty Opening or Closing Windows
If your windows are deforming or you discover it increasingly challenging to operate them, this might recommend that the frames are deteriorating, making replacement required.
5. Noticeable Damage
Cracks, chips, or stained glass substantially compromise your windows' performance and aesthetic appeal. Such noticeable damage warrants replacement for both performance and curb appeal.

Expense of Double Glazing Replacement
The cost of changing double glazing can differ extensively based upon numerous elements, including the size of the windows, the type of glass, and labor expenses. Here is a rough estimate:
Window TypeAverage Cost (per window)Standard uPVC₤ 300 - ₤ 800Aluminium₤ 600 - ₤ 1200Wood₤ 800 - ₤ 2000Specialized Shapes₤ 1000 - ₤ 3000
Note: Above costs can vary based on place, window size, and extra functions like tinted glass or sophisticated energy-efficient finishings.
